Product Description
Product Description
The Milwaukee M12 FUEL™ 3/8" Installation Drill/Driver (2505-20) is a versatile 4-in-1 installation system designed for professionals who need maximum access, precision, and flexibility. Powered by a POWERSTATE™ Brushless Motor, it delivers up to 300 in-lbs of torque and 1,600 RPM, while its interchangeable heads allow you to quickly switch between a 3/8" drill chuck, 1/4" hex chuck, offset attachment, and right-angle attachment. This compact installation drill is ideal for cabinet installers, electricians, HVAC technicians, plumbers, and remodelers working in confined spaces.

7. Can the attachments be repositioned?
Yes. The four dedicated heads can attach in 16 different positions, providing excellent access at a variety of working angles.
8. Can the attachments be used with the right-angle head?
Yes. The 1/4" hex, 3/8" chuck, and offset attachments can connect to the right-angle attachment for additional drilling and fastening configurations.
9. Is the Milwaukee 2505-20 a hammer drill?
No. The 2505-20 is an installation drill/driver and does not have a hammer-drilling function.
10. What is the offset attachment used for?
The offset attachment allows the tool to reach fasteners close to edges, inside tight corners, and against finished surfaces where a conventional drill may not fit.
